Honey Garlic Butter Roasted Carrots Pressure Cooker Recipe

Elevate your vegetable game with these delicious honey roasted carrots with garlic butter. Easy to make and packed with flavor, they make the perfect side dish for any meal.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 25 minutes
Servings 4 servings
Calories 100 kcal

Ingredients
  

Main ingredients

  • 1 Package Baby Carrots These little guys cook evenly and soak up flavors real good.
  • 1 Tablespoon Olive Oil Adds a bit of fruity richness that butter alone doesn’t have.
  • 1 Teaspoon Kosher Salt Good for seasoning during cooking, helps pull out natural sweetness.
  • ½ Teaspoon Black Pepper Gives just a hint of spice, not overwhelming.
  • 2 Tablespoons Butter, melted This is your richness that makes the carrots feel indulgent.
  • 2 Cloves Garlic Fresh and minced, garlic’s gotta be fresh for that punchy taste.
  • 1 Tablespoon Honey Sweetens the deal naturally while caramelizing nicely under heat.
  • 1 Teaspoon Lemon Flaked Salt Adds a zesty brightness and finish to the dish.
  • Extra Lemon Flaked Salt For sprinkling on just before serving, love that texture.

Instructions
 

Instructions

  • Preheat your oven to 425 degrees Fahrenheit. You wanna get that heat just right to get some caramelization happening.
  • Grab a big bowl and stir together melted butter, olive oil, honey, minced garlic, kosher salt, black pepper, and half the lemon flaked salt. This mixture is where the flavor starts to build.
  • Toss the baby carrots in the bowl with that buttery honey goodness. Make sure every carrot is well coated so none get left behind in flavor.
  • Spread your coated carrots in one single layer on a baking sheet. Crowding will steam them instead of roasting, so don’t skimp on space.
  • Throw the tray in the oven and roast for 25-30 minutes. Halfway through, stir ‘em up so they cook evenly and get caramelized on all sides.
  • Once they’re tender and golden, pull ‘em out and sprinkle the rest of that lemon flaked salt on top right before serving. It’s the little finish that makes ’em pop.
